Клонировать имя пользователя, пароль для URL на основе ssh - PullRequest
0 голосов
/ 05 июля 2018

Я хочу клонировать репозиторий Git, используя ssh URL, используя сценарий оболочки как часть автоматизации.

Поэтому необходимо передать имя пользователя и пароль в команде клона.

Как передать имя пользователя и пароль в одной строке.

Для URL на основе HTTP / HTTPS я передал имя пользователя, пароль в команде clone в скрипте, все работает нормально. Но для URL на основе ssh это не так.

Общая команда клонирования на основе SSH, которую я использую:

git clone ssh://{user}@{host}:{port}/{repo}

1 Ответ

0 голосов
/ 05 июля 2018
sshpass -p password git clone ssh://{user}@{host}:{port}/{repo}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...